MADISON - Walter L. "Ben" Washburn passed away peacefully surrounded by his loving family on Sunday, June 14, 2015 at age 90.
Ben was born in Portage on September 4, 1924, the son of the late Walter B. and Grace (Hettinger) Washburn. He married Sarah Ann Tillotson on October 25, 1946.
He attended the UW Medical School and graduated on May 24, 1947. He completed his residency in Kansas City, MO. Ben was a veteran having served with the U.S. Army from 1943 to 1945. Due to a doctor's draft in 1955, he spent 17 months in Bremerhaven, Germany. He and his family returned to Madison in 1957.
Ben was a Family Practitioner for 44 years. After working for area hospitals and clinics, he opened the Odana Medical Clinic. He loved his practice, patients, and colleagues. He had the utmost admiration and respect for the nurses with whom he worked. He was the former Chief of Staff of Madison General Hospital, served on the Medical Ethics Committee, was the former Chairman of the Medical Assistant Advisory Committee at MATC and former Secretary of the State Medical Examining Board (4 years). He was also a member of the Madison Audubon Society, Physicians for Social Responsibility and a longtime member of Covenant Presbyterian Church.
Beginning with their experiences in Germany, Ben and Sally became avid travelers. They developed interest in other countries, cultures, history and the wellbeing of people all around the world. This led them to travels in Russia, China, and Africa as well as to India, Nepal and Pakistan, where Ben did volunteer medical work.
